WebbRM2M9A5H9 – United States Navy - Grumman F7F-2D Tigercat 80335 of VU-3 at Miramar NAS. Built as an F7F-2N, the majority of the -2Ns, including 80335, were converted to F7F-2D as drone director / launch aircraft for Globe KD2G target drones, with a raised cockpit for the drone director, where the radar operator sat in the -2N. WebbThe Grumman F7F Tigercat was the first twin-engined fighter aircraft to enter service with the United States Navy. Designed for the new Midway -class aircraft carriers, the aircraft … WebbRM2M9A35N–Grumman F7F-3P Tigercat G-RUMT (msn C.167) (ex BuAer No. 80425 - US civil registration N7235C) at RAF Fairford for a Royal International Air Tattoo air show. 80425 (MSN C.167) was delivered to the US Navy on 10 June 1945 and stored at NAS Litchfield Park, Arizona in March 1954.

WebbWith 4,200 HP the Tigercat could fly 71 MPH faster than the previous Hellcat, making it the Navy’s new choice for carrier-borne fighting at a top speed of 460 MPH. Webb22 jan. 2013 · F7F Tigercat Walkaround. A few years ago I was volunteering as a docent at the Kalamazoo Air Zoo in Kalamazoo, Michigan. I had just gotten my first digital camera, and decided to do a few walkarounds of some of the aircraft. This is F7F-3P BuNo 80390. During her military career I'm told she flew a few recon missions over Japan during the ...
